Brief Summary

Objective: The study aimed to assess the effect of topical application of an amino acid + sodium hyaluronate acid gel after lower third molar extraction. Study design: 136 patients requiring lower th...

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• age 18 between 25 years,
  • ASA I or II,
  • necessitating lower wisdom tooth extraction,
  • no evidence of inflammation

Exclusion

  • smoking more than 10 cigarettes a day,
  • pregnancy,
  • uncontrolled diabetes mellitus,
  • any diseases contraindicating the surgical procedure,
  • use of bisphosphonate,
  • antibiotics or NSAIDs during the 30 days preceding surgery
